Bush tours flood-ravaged Iowa

US President George Bush, whose administration came under fire for its handling of Hurricane Katrina in 2005, arrived today to inspect two of Iowa’s flooded cities, where families and businesses are knee-deep in the disheartening aftermath of severe floods.

The visits to Cedar Rapids and Iowa City were Bush’s first in the region since heavy rains sent rivers surging over their banks.
